    Information sharing across the supply chain is an effective strategy to mitigate the bullwhip effect. For example, it has been successfully implemented in Wal-Mart's distribution system. Individual Wal-Mart stores transmit point-of-sale (POS) data from the cash register back to corporate headquarters several times a day. This demand information ...

    A marketing decision support system (sometimes abbreviated MKDSS) is a decision support system for marketing activity. The system is used to help businesses explore different scenarios by manipulating already collected data from past events.
